How much does a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II make in Ogden, UT? The average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II salary in Ogden, UT is $75,200 as of March 26, 2024, but the range typically falls between $66,400 and $85,300.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Job Description

The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II collects and analyzes financial data, ensuring that all reporting is in compliance with SEC and GAAP reporting guidelines. Prepares periodic financial statements required for external reporting. Being a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II prepares internal reports as required. Consolidates entries and accounts to be utilized in financial statements. In addition,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II researches accounting rules and regulations and makes recommendations regarding company policy. May provide support and assistance to external auditors. Requires a bachelor's degree of Accounting or Finance.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. Being a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. Working as a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

These charts show the average base salary (core compensation), as well as the average total cash compensation for the job of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II in Ogden, UT. The base salary for Financial Statements and Reporting Accountant II ranges from $66,400 to $85,300 with the average base salary of $75,200. The total cash compensation, which includes base, and annual incentives, can vary anywhere from $68,300 to $89,900 with the average total cash compensation of $78,200.
